The Role


In the Systems Engineer role you will be responsible for ensuring that all hardware and software subsystems integrate seamlessly into working products. You will own the electrical architecture and collaborate with hardware and software development teams to define engineering requirements and subsystem interfaces. You will help troubleshoot problems and define metrics and methods for evaluating and tracking system performance. You will also work closely with test engineers to ensure correct verification and validation of the systems.

What You’ll Do


  • Contribute to the development and maintenance of existing and new hardware and software systems.
  • Drive system-level decisions regarding sophisticated hardware/software trade-offs.
  • Manage integration testing of the system as new hardware and software components come together.
  • Define engineering requirements and manage their traceability through the development process.
  • Provide frequent and clear communication to other teams, peers, and stakeholders.
  • Conduct system level risk analysis (e.g., STPA, FMEA) to identify and manage risks during development.
  • Collaborate with Product managers to define validation metrics.
  • Work with hardware and software leads to define system performance metrics and methods for tracking them.
  • Analyze performance data, as well as system and software architecture to improve our existing systems.
  • May support in training new individuals on the team.
  • Partner with Engineering, Product, and Program managers to keep technical progress on track.
  • Be the technical owner of the electrical system to ensure that all of its components integrate functionally and efficiently into a working product.
  • Establish and manage an automated hardware-in-the-loop test framework
